
Vegan Tiramisu Truffles
These rich and creamy vegan tiramisu truffles are a delightful bite-sized spin on the classic Italian dessert. Featuring a fudgy almond and vegan cream cheese filling, coated in espresso coffee chocolate, and dusted with cocoa powder, they are an easy-to-make treat perfect for any occasion, especially the holidays.
Instructions
- 1
Bring coconut cream (0.5 cup) and espresso (2 tbsp) to a boil in a saucepan. Remove from heat, add chocolate chips (1.5 cups), let sit a few seconds, then whisk until melted. If thin, refrigerate for 10 minutes.
- 2
For the cheese mixture: Combine plus 2 tbsp almond flour (0.5 cup), almond extract (1 drop) (optional), vegan cream cheese (2 tbsp), maple syrup (2 tbsp), salt (0.125 tsp), and lemon juice (0.5 tsp) in a bowl. Mix well, adding more [almond flour] or oat flour (1 tsp) if too sticky. Refrigerate for 15 minutes to stiffen.
- 3
Scoop the cheese mixture into 0.5 inch balls. Coat each ball in the melted chocolate mixture and place on parchment paper. Chill for 15 minutes (or freeze for faster setting) until chocolate hardens. Dip again in chocolate for a thick coating. Chill for another 15-20 minutes until set.
- 4
Place cocoa powder (2 tbsp) in a shallow bowl. Roll each truffle between your palms to create an even sphere. Roll them in the [cocoa powder] to coat. Refrigerate until ready to serve.
